As the population in major cities grew after World War One, so did the growth of Black Basketball. Teams such as the Harlem Renaissance (Rens) and the Original Celtics dominated the streetball scene with the Rens being seen by many as the preeminent team in the 1920s. The famous Rens and other “street ball” teams went on the road to compete against all-white teams after World War Two. The Black basketball players from Washington D.C. and other major cities began to enroll in historically Black Colleges (CIAA) and made the Central Intercollegiate Athletic Association one of the strongest conferences in the country.
